The video tutorial explains how to interpret a speed-time graph for a car journey. It covers calculating velocity using the area under the graph, specifically a trapezium, and describes acceleration at different stages of the journey.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of unit conversion and understanding graph gradients to determine acceleration and deceleration. Key points include calculating velocity, understanding acceleration, and the significance of graph areas.
